One of the most appealing features of homes in this area is the growing trend of geothermal heating. This innovative and eco-friendly system harnesses the earth's natural energy to provide efficient heating and cooling solutions for your home. By utilizing the stable temperatures found underground, geothermal systems can significantly reduce energy costs and carbon footprints, making them an excellent choice for environmentally conscious homeowners.
